Height-adjustable commodity shelf structure

By introducing a height adjustment assembly consisting of a mounting plate, handle, and adjustment piece into the dishwasher, the inconvenience of having to remove the dish rack for height adjustment in existing technologies is solved, enabling convenient adjustment of the dish rack height and improving ease of operation.

Technical Problem

The height adjustment of the upper rack in existing dishwashers requires removing and reinstalling the rack, which is inconvenient.

Method used

The height adjustment assembly consists of a mounting plate, a handle, a first elastic element, and an adjusting element. The adjusting element drives the handle to overcome the elastic force of the elastic element and rotate, thereby releasing the limit on the shelf and allowing it to move to a low or high position under the action of gravity, achieving simple height adjustment.

Benefits of technology

It enables convenient adjustment of the height of the dishwasher's upper rack, simplifies the operation process, and improves ease of use.

Abstract

The utility model discloses a height-adjustable commodity shelf structure, which comprises a commodity shelf body (1) and two groups of height adjusting components (2), and is characterized in that each height adjusting component (2) comprises a mounting plate (21), and the commodity shelf body (1) can be mounted on the mounting plate (21) in a manner of moving up and down; the handle (22) is rotationally connected to the mounting plate (21), and a supporting arm (221) is arranged at the tail of the handle (22); the first elastic piece (23) acts between the mounting plate (21) and the handle (22); the adjusting part (24) is used for driving the handle (22) to overcome the elastic force effect of the first elastic part (23) to rotate, so that the supporting arm (221) relieves supporting of the limiting part of the storage rack body (1), and then the storage rack body (1) in the high position moves to the low position under the gravity effect. Compared with the prior art, the height-adjustable commodity shelf structure is simple to operate.

TECHNICAL FIELD

[0001] The utility model relates to kitchen equipment technical field, specifically point to a height adjustable storage rack structure. BACKGROUND

[0002] With the improvement of living standards, dish washer as kitchen supplies is used more and more, the existing dish washer generally has multilayer basket, in order to realize the accommodation of different size tableware in the dish washer, the lifting structure that the height of adjustable upper basket in the inner container of dish washer is generally provided at the upper basket of dish washer, the interval between upper basket and inner container top wall is adjusted, and then the placement of different size tableware is realized.

[0003] The existing upper basket adjusting mechanism is provided with different height clamping grooves on the left and right sides of the basket, the support mechanism of the upper basket is clamped into the clamping grooves of different heights to realize the adjustment of the height of the basket, and the Chinese patent No.

[0004] However, for the above scheme, the whole basket needs to be disassembled and reinstalled every time the height of the basket is changed, and the operation is inconvenient. INVENTION CONTENTS

[0005] The utility model solves the technical problem that the utility model wants to solve is in view of the present situation of prior art, provide a height adjustable storage rack structure convenient operation.

[0006] The utility model solves the technical problems that the utility model adopts the technical scheme of the following: a height adjustable storage rack structure, including storage rack body and two groups of height adjusting assembly that are respectively arranged on the left and right sides of the storage rack body, characterized by: the left and right sides of the storage rack body are all provided with limit piece;

[0007] Each height adjusting assembly includes

[0008] Mounting plate, the storage rack body can be installed on the mounting plate and move up and down;

[0009] Handle, rotationally connected on the mounting plate, the tail of the handle has the support arm for supporting the limit piece;

[0010] First elastic piece, acts between the mounting plate and handle, so that the support arm of handle always has the tendency of supporting under the limit piece; And

[0011] Adjusting piece, for driving the handle to rotate against the elastic force of first elastic piece, so that the support arm removes the support to the limit piece, and then makes the storage rack body in high position move to low position under the action of gravity.

[0012] In order to movably install the shelf body on the mounting plate, the left and right sides of the shelf body are provided with guide rods extending in the vertical direction, and the mounting plate is provided with guide sleeves sleeved on the outer periphery of the guide rods.

[0013] In order to limit the position of the shelf body when it is in the low position, the left and right sides of the shelf body are provided with limiting rods which abut against the top of the mounting plate when the shelf body is in the low position.

[0014] In order to facilitate the positioning of the handle in the state without external force, the handle is installed on the outer side of the mounting plate, the support arm extends inward from the tail of the handle and gradually approaches the shelf body, and the mounting plate is provided with a gap hole for the support arm to pass through, and in the state without external force, the tail of the handle abuts against the outer side of the mounting plate.

[0015] In order to facilitate the driving of the support arm to rotate outward while lifting the shelf body, the bottom surface of the support arm is provided with a first guide inclined surface gradually approaching the shelf body from bottom to top.

[0016] In order to facilitate the rotational connection of the handle on the mounting plate, the front side of the mounting plate is provided with a hinge seat, and the handle is rotatably connected to the hinge seat through a rotating shaft.

[0017] In order to facilitate the installation of the first elastic member, a groove is formed in the handle head corresponding to the position of the hinge seat, and the first elastic member is a compression spring, the first end of which is accommodated in the groove, and the second end of the compression spring abuts against the outer side wall of the hinge seat.

[0018] In order to drive the handle, the adjusting member comprises

[0019] a base fixed relative to the mounting plate; and

[0020] a button movably installed on the base and located above the handle, and the top surface of the handle head corresponding to the button is provided with a second guide inclined surface gradually approaching the shelf body from bottom to top.

[0021] In order to facilitate the reset of the button, the adjusting member further comprises a second elastic member acting between the base and the button, so that the button always has a tendency to move upward.

[0022] In order to facilitate the installation of the second elastic member, the second elastic member is a torsion spring rotatably connected in the base, and the two ends thereof are connected with the base and the button respectively.

[0023] To facilitate the transmission and engagement between the button and the handle head, the bottom of the button has a third guide slope parallel to the second guide slope.

[0024] To ensure the stability of the shelf body when it is in a high position, the limiting member is a horizontal bar extending in the front-to-back direction, and the top surface of the support arm has a recessed receiving groove. When the shelf body is in a high position, the horizontal bar is at least partially confined within the receiving groove.

[0025] Compared with the prior art, the advantages of this utility model are as follows: the height adjustment assembly is composed of a mounting plate, a handle, a first elastic element and an adjusting element. The adjusting element can drive the handle to rotate against the elastic force of the first elastic element, so that the support arm of the handle releases the support of the limiting element of the shelf body, thereby allowing the shelf body in the high position to move to the low position under the action of gravity. The shelf structure is height adjustable and easy to operate. Attached Figure Description

[0034] As shown in the preferred embodiment of the height-adjustable storage rack structure of the present application. The storage rack structure can be installed as a bowl rack structure in the cabinet of a dishwasher, comprising a storage rack body 1 and two groups of height adjustment assemblies 2 respectively arranged on the left and right sides of the storage rack body 1. Figures 1 to 6

[0035] Among them, the left and right sides of the storage rack body 1 are provided with guide rods 11 extending in the vertical direction, limiting rods 12 arranged obliquely, and cross rods 13 extending in the front and rear directions.

[0036] Each height adjustment assembly 2 comprises a mounting plate 21, a handle 22, a first elastic member 23 and an adjustment member 24.

[0037] Specifically, the mounting plate 21 has a plurality of guide sleeves 211 corresponding to the guide rods 11, each guide sleeve 211 being sleeved on the outer periphery of the corresponding guide rod 11, so that the storage rack body 1 can be movably mounted on the mounting plate 21; the front side of the mounting plate 21 has a hinge seat 212; the mounting plate 21 is provided with a clearance hole 213 at a position behind the hinge seat 212.

[0038] The handle 22 is located on the outside of the mounting plate 21, and the middle part of the handle 22 is rotatably connected to the hinge seat 212 through a vertically arranged pivot 220; the tail of the handle 22 has a support arm 221 extending inwardly and gradually approaching the storage rack body 1, the support arm 221 extending into the mounting plate 21 through the clearance hole 213 and supporting the cross rod 13, the bottom surface of the support arm 221 has a first guide slope 2211 gradually approaching the storage rack body 1 from bottom to top, and the top surface of the support arm 221 has a concave accommodating groove 2212; the head of the handle 22 is provided with a groove 222 corresponding to the position of the hinge seat 212.

[0039] ​The first elastic member 23 is a compression spring, the first end of which is contained in the groove 222, and the second end of which abuts against the outer side wall of the hinge seat 212, so that the support arm 221 of the handle 22 always has a tendency to be supported under the horizontal rod 13, and the tail of the handle 22 abuts against the outer side of the mounting plate 21 in the state without external force.

[0040] The adjusting member 24 is used to drive the handle 22 to rotate against the elastic force of the first elastic member 23, so that the support arm 221 releases the support to the horizontal rod 13, and further so that the shelf body 1 in the high position moves to the low position under the action of gravity:

[0041] In the state that the shelf body 1 is in the high position, as shown in Figure 2 and Figure 3 , the support arm 221 is supported under the horizontal rod 13, and the horizontal rod 13 is limited in the containing groove 2212;

[0042] In the state that the shelf body 1 is in the low position, as shown in Figure 4 and Figure 5 , the limiting rod 12 abuts against the top of the mounting plate 21.

[0043] In the embodiment, the adjusting member 24 comprises a base 241, a button 242 and a second elastic member 243. Specifically, the base 241 is connected to the top side of the mounting plate 21; the button 242 is movably installed on the base 241 and is located above the handle 22, the head of the handle 22 has a second guide slope 223 corresponding to the top surface of the button 242, which gradually approaches the shelf body 1 from bottom to top, and the bottom end of the button 242 has a third guide slope 2421 parallel to the second guide slope 223; the second elastic member 243 is a torsion spring, which is rotatably connected in the base 241 and has two ends connected with the base 241 and the button 242 respectively, so that the button 242 always has a tendency to move upward.

[0044] The working principle of the embodiment is as follows:

[0045] (1) During installation, the mounting plate 21 can be installed on the side wall inside the dishwasher box body;

[0046] (2) During work: as shown in Figure 2 and Figure 3 , in the state that the shelf body 1 is in the high position, the support arm 221 is supported under the horizontal rod 13, and the horizontal rod 13 is limited in the containing groove 2212;

[0047] If you want to adjust the storage rack body 1 to the low position, you only need to press the button 242 downward, the head of the driving handle 22 rotates inward, the support arm 221 at the tail of the handle 22 rotates outward, and gradually releases the support to the horizontal rod 13, so that the storage rack body 1 falls under the action of gravity until the limiting rod 12 abuts against the top of the mounting plate 21, at this time, as shown in Figure 4 and Figure 5 , the storage rack body 1 is in the low position; in addition, after releasing the button 242, the button 242 will reset under the elastic force of the second elastic member 243, and the handle 22 will reset under the elastic force of the first elastic member 23;

[0048] If you want to adjust the storage rack body 1 to the high position, you only need to lift the storage rack body 1 upward, during the lifting process of the storage rack body 1, the horizontal rod 13 will contact the first guide slope 2211, the lifting horizontal rod 13 will exert an outward rotating thrust on the support arm 221 until the horizontal rod 13 passes the support arm 221, the support arm 221 will reset under the elastic force of the first elastic member 23 and support under the horizontal rod 13, at this time, as shown in Figure 2 and Figure 3 , the storage rack body 1 returns to the high position.
